Mindrift connects specialists with project-based AI opportunities for leading tech companies, focusing on testing and improving AI systems. This role involves designing computational STEM problems that require expertise in Python programming and machine learning.
Contributors can earn up to $55 per hour based on their experience and project complexity. Ideal candidates will have strong problem-solving skills and a solid portfolio showcasing previous work.

How to prepare for a job interview at Mindrift
✨Showcase Your Portfolio
Make sure to bring along a solid portfolio that highlights your previous work in machine learning and Python programming. Be ready to discuss specific projects, the challenges you faced, and how you overcame them. This will demonstrate your problem-solving skills and give the interviewers a clear picture of your capabilities.
✨Understand the Role
Before the interview, take some time to thoroughly understand the job description and the specific requirements of the role. Familiarise yourself with the types of AI problems you might be designing and evaluating. This will help you tailor your answers and show that you're genuinely interested in the position.
✨Prepare for Technical Questions
Expect technical questions related to machine learning algorithms, Python programming, and problem design. Brush up on key concepts and be prepared to solve problems on the spot. Practising coding challenges can also help you feel more confident during the technical portion of the interview.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ask insightful questions about the company’s projects and future goals. This shows your enthusiasm for the role and hel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you. Plus, it gives you a chance to engage with the interviewers on a deeper level.
